From 4ea5e2de1b6e43808f49c40156e879ec33d1504a Mon Sep 17 00:00:00 2001 From: Erez Shinan Date: Thu, 13 Oct 2022 13:21:26 +0200 Subject: [PATCH] Bugfix: Joindiff crashed when no numeric columns were used. --- data_diff/joindiff_tables.py |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/data_diff/joindiff_tables.py b/data_diff/joindiff_tables.py index 58246def..b1134774 100644 --- a/data_diff/joindiff_tables.py +++ b/data_diff/joindiff_tables.py @@ -34,7 +34,11 @@ def merge_dicts(dicts): i = iter(dicts) - res = next(i) + try: + res = next(i) + except StopIteration: + return {} + for d in i: res.update(d) return res